Match the following bacteria with the diseases
Column-I Column-II
A. Treponema pallidum - I. Plague
B. Yersinia pestis - II. Anthrax
C. Bacillus anthracis - III. Syphilis
D. Vibrio - IV. Cholera
(a) A – III; B – I; C – II; D – IV
(b) A – IV; B – I; C – II; D – III
(c) A – III; B – II; C – I; D – IV
(d) A – I; B – III; C – II; D – IV

(a) A – III; B – I; C – II; D – IV
Explanation:
Plague is a deadly infectious disease that is caused by the enterobacteria Yersinia pestis (formely know as Pasteurella pestis). Anthrax is an infectious bacterial disease which involves skin, gastrointestinal tract or lungs. Syphilis is a sexually transmitted infection caused by bacterium Treponema pallidium. Cholera is an infection in the small intestine caused by the bacterium Vibrio cholerae that causes a large amount of watery diarrhea and vomiting.
